How to force a download when you cant edit the html of your web page. When its anything other than pdf the page renders normally as html. Forcing users to browse pdf files makes usability approximately 300% worse compared to html pages. The documents can be formatted in number of types such as pdf, excel, word, html or xml. Viewers can then download and save the file to their computer.
The following page presents a list of contacts for an account. Using jspdf library, you can download the div contents as a pdf. Nov 08, 2018 in this tutorial we will outline how you can always force a file to download rather than showing it in the visitors browser. You can change the default program for pdf files to open it in a program thats more suitable and featurerich, such as acrobat reader dc or acrobat dc. Click convert html to pdf and wait until processing completes. If theres no means of any server side code which streams the pdf file, then you need to configure it at webserver level. Why all my pdf files are converted to avg html document. If you save a pdf as html web page the resulting html will have the following doctype declaration. Browsers automatically save webpage images, stylesheets, favicon, and other files directly on your computer this is called caching. Browsers cannot read zip file so it will force a download. You can also save individual pdfs to other file formats, including text, xml, html, and microsoft word. One for the full name of the file you want to send to the browser. Html to pdf, how to convert html to pdf adobe acrobat.
How to force a file to download instead of open in the browser using. No, its not an extension, but it works via the sharing feature. This should open our page in a web browser and you should be greeted by a rather simple looking header which reads this is a big bold heading followed by a bulleted. Open the document, file, or web page that youd like to save in pdf format. How to convert html page to pdf and save in server, cannot. Render a visualforce page as pdf from apex visualforce.
The code below will tell the browser to prompt the user to save the file. In this tutorial you will learn how to force download a file using php. Please advice how can i automatically change back from avg html document to pdf files again. My problem is that my file seems to get stuck on reconstructing document when im trying to save as an html file. All files in that folder, when accessed, should prompt the save as dialog box for the appropriate browser.
Only use pdf for documents that users are likely to print. Save the file on your local drive and call it qstyles. There are no restrictions on allowed values, and the browser will automatically detect the correct file extension and add it to the file. Click to download this markup is easier to understand and is supported by all modern browsers, but may not be supported by all content management systems. So heres a simple snippet for when you want to force a download of a file such as a pdf. In this tutorial, we will show you how to display pdf file in the web page using html tag.
In this example i will show how easy it is to generate pdf documents using visualforce pages adn with adding little bit of your coding skills you can easily create other formats as well of course with certain limitations. How to change browser download settings for pdf files. Make sure that you have all the contents to be saved in sample div. How to force your pdf file to download instead of open in browser. Below we show how to convert web pages to pdf documents step 1. Free html to pdf converter asp net mvc html to pdf api. When i open an html file in word 2007 and save as a pdf file with the pdf converter installed the hyperlinks remain active in the converted pdf file. Convert pdf to html online and free this page also contains information on the pdf and html file extensions. If the value is omitted, the original filename is used. Force a file to download instead of showing up in the browser. Put all files you want to force to download in their own folder. Once done, the app will automatically download the html version of the webpage.
In this case, the file will be downloaded as expenses. How to create word, pdf or excel files with salesforce data. By default, windows 10 uses microsoft edge as the default program to open pdf files. So when you doubleclick a pdf file to open it, it will be automatically opened in microsoft edge browser, whether a pdf reader is installed on your windows 10 or not. If you want to force a save as dialog automatically when a link is clicked via code from the server side, you have to send the file back through code using response. It is an allinone pdf software, which enable you edit, convert, create, annotate, protect, sign pdf files and fill out pdf forms. Add a save as pdf feature to a visualforce page visualforce. How to make pdf file downloadable in html link using php. Please advice how can i automatically change back from avg html document to pdf.
Links are placed at the beginning of the resulting html or xml document. Caching lets you visit the same site multiple times without having to download those files over and over again you save time, the hosting company saves bandwidth, and the world makes sense again. Using the anchor tag and download attributes to force. Dec 20, 2018 why all my pdf files are automatically changed to avg html document today. Render a visualforce page as a pdf file salesforce developers. What you just created is a style that can be associated to an html, or visualforce component that supports style classes. Force a file to download when link is clicked phil owen. By default, most downloaded pdf files open in the internet browser currently in use, usually in a new window or tab. If both filename and saveas are specified, then the save as dialog will be displayed, prepopulated with the specified filename. I have several pdf files that id like to export as html5. Click the convert to pdf button in the adobe pdf toolbar to start the pdf conversion. The free html to pdf converter offers most of the features the professional sdk offers, the only notable limitation is that it can only generate pdf documents up to 5 pages long.
I need for images to be downloaded directly by default and not rendered by the browser. And then, when the user clicks on the anchor link, they will download the href location and save the resultant. Visualforce pages rendered as pdfs will either display in the browser or download as a pdf file, depending on your browser settings. Converting a page to a pdf file salesforce developers. How to download html content as pdf file using javascript. Apr 30, 2017 recently, i was experimenting with telerik kendo ui html framework and in particular i was exploring the pdf export feature that allows you to convert html content into a pdf. Follow these steps to use adobe acrobat or reader to save your changes to an adobe pdf or pdf portfolio in the original pdf or in a copy of the pdf. Add a save as pdf feature to a visualforce page render a visualforce page as pdf from apex fonts available when using visualforce pdf rendering visualforce pdf rendering considerations and limitations. The other variable will hold the name as it appears in the save as dialog in the browser. How to download a pdf file forcefully instead of opening it in a browser using js. Why all my pdf files are automatically changed to avg html document today.
How to activate html hyperlinks when saving a html file from word 2010 to pdf format i have both office 2007 and office 2010. The value of the attribute will be the name of the downloaded file. My problem is that my file seems to get stuck on reconstructing document when im trying to save as an html. Download a div in a html page as pdf using javascript jsfiddle code playground close.
When you open a file in your browser by clicking a link or by typing in an url in the address bar, the browser examines the content type of the file you are requesting. In this tutorial youll learn how to download files like images, word or pdf documents, exe or zip files. Below are working jquery examples for creating documents. May 24, 2018 once you click on button, the pop up to save content inside particular div will show up. Our api reference lists all the generation options and our style and formatting guide will help make it look perfect. Add the save to pdf link to your web site and enable your visitors to save your web pages to pdf in one click. Steps on how to make a link prompt visitor to download. Hey guys i am sending leads from email link to download offer in pdf format, its off my site, i have it in the media section off my wp site. How to convert pdf to html, pdf to html adobe acrobat. Test your javascript, css, html or coffeescript online with jsfiddle code editor. Feb, 2020 an html anchor link is the easiest way to display a pdf file. Name the pdf file and save it in a desired location.
Save html in edge is an app available for both windows 10 pc and mobile which allows you to save a web page as html file. Pdf to html convert your pdf to html for free online. Force a pdf download vs allowing the user to view in browser first. Force a file to download instead of opening it in a. Force a file to download instead of opening it in a browser with html. The html tag is the best option to embed pdf document on the web page.
Html comments and ie conditional comments html tags added or modified by visualforce using a custom doctype. A common way to view a pdf form is in a web browser, for example, when you click a link on a website. Now navigate to wherever you chose to save your file i recommend creating a new folder on your desktop to store all of your learning files and double click test. Force a file to download pdf, image, audio rather than. How to force your pdf file to download instead of open in. I have some big size pdf catalogs at my website, and i need to link these as download. Using the anchor tag and download attributes to force a file download by ben nadel on.
Enter a file name and save your new pdf file in a desired location. How to embed pdf document in html web page codexworld. Most computer users know to unzip the file and get the content from inside. How to force a file to download instead of open in the browser using only html. Force to open save as popup open at text link click for pdf in html. To embed accessibility information within a pdf form file, select generate accessibility information tags for acrobat. Each component found in the body of the save settings. A visualforce page rendered as a pdf file displays either in the browser or is downloaded, depending on the browsers settings. Is there a way to force a browser with a javascript routine to save a file as save as after clicking a link. View demo this attribute is extremely useful in cases where generated files are in use the file name on the server side needs to be incredibly unique, but the download attribute allows the file name to be meaningful to user. Then, recommend to the web page viewer that they rightclick the link and choose the option to save or save as the file. Save basic items save standard items save custom items view saved page info.
Click the save options tab and set the save options. Force a browser to save file as after clicking link. But if you want to display a pdf document on the web page, pdf file needs to be embedded in html. Generates bookmark links to content for html or xml documents.
Html to pdf, how to convert html to pdf adobe acrobat dc. With docraptor, its fast and painless to convert html, css, and javascript into pdf and xls documents with jquery. Once you click on button, the pop up to save content inside particular div will show up. In this tutorial we will outline how you can always force a file to download rather than showing it in the visitors browser. On a windows computer, open an html web page in internet explorer, chrome, or firefox.
To create a log file of the saved pdf form file, select generate log file when saving. This can also be used to download the data uri representation of an html canvas object for fun and profit. Microsoft edge is the default program for opening pdf files on windows 10. Normally, you dont necessarily need to use any server side scripting language like php to download images, zip files, pdf documents, exe files, etc. Among various pdf converters in the market, pdfelement is the most costeffective pdf solution to convert html to pdf. Hi, in my page user click view button i want to pass the url which i want to convert pdf, and save the converted pdf files into my server location, and this converted pdf will open in. The log file is placed in the same directory as the saved form. The experience is similar to how you share any webpage over email or whatsapp. All you need to do is add a download attribute to your link html. Automatically download pdfs via jquery have you ever wanted to have a link to a resource, such as a pdf file, and have that resource be automatically downloaded when the link is clicked.
How to download html content as pdf file using javascript in this article im going to explain you one the most interesting and useful tutorial, that is download the html content as in the pdf format onclick using jspdf jquery file. How to embed a pdf file in html without a download, save and. How to force download files using php tutorial republic. Save the form on your computer, and then open it directly in acrobat or acrobat reader. Hi i have a large pdf file that if i create an anchor link to, the. Create a link to download the file on the web page using the html tag. Learn more about converting html pages to pdf files use our online tool to go from web pages to pdfs faster than ever. To proceed, select your browser from the list below and follow the instructions. You can add a save as pdf element to a page to dynamically toggle between rendering the page as html or as a pdf file. Force a file to download instead of showing up in the. May 18, 2018 use this to embed your pdf file without save and print options code pdf. The download attribute also triggers a force download, something that i used to do on the server side with php. This page contains steps on how to make the browser download pdf files automatically, rather than open in a new tab. Each time the page loads, in both edit and view modes, i get a file download dialog box asking do you want to save this file.
I am trying this with a pdf ebook the book is about 350 pages. Export pdf files to html using acrobat xi learn how to convert pdf to html, so the editable html file maintains images, tables, hyperlinks, and table of contents. Click the convert to pdf button in the adobe pdf toolbar. Before you can use the style in the visualforce component, you need to upload the stylesheet as a static resource to your force. My course site is in html and stored in files on canvas. Below example to illustrate concept of downloading pdf file using. How to convert my html form into a pdf using scripting quora. Associate pdf files to always open in reader or acrobat on. To force the browser to display the save as dialog, youll need to fool it a bit.
The renderedcontenttype property provides a mime type value that is used by the contenttype attribute of the visualforce component. Oct 24, 20 thank you for your video, its very helpful. How to display pdf in browser not downloading canvas lms. If you are offering a large item, even if this is a pdf it is recommended to force this download. I know you can export as html from version xi, but im wondering if its html5. This wikihow teaches you how to save a document in pdf format in windows 10 and mac os. A really simple way to achieve this, without using external download sites or modifying headers etc. This will always trigger the save open dialog, and its still easy for people to doubleclick the pdf windows the program associated with. Specific behavior depends on the browser, version, and user settings, and is outside the control of visualforce. Pdf is a file format developed by adobe systems for representing documents in a manner that is separate from the original operating system, application or hardware from where it was originally created. I have a page that contains a page viewer web part.
Wicked pdf uses the shell utility wkhtmltopdf to serve a pdf file to a user from html. Its a better way to share, present, and organize your web pages and you can try it right now from. For example, lets say you have a pdf receipt or an mp3 file that you want to let people download. However, when i do the same in word 2010 the hyperlinks do not. How to activate html hyperlinks when saving a html file. Force a file to download instead of opening it in a browser. How do i prevent sharepoint from asking to download html. Convert r markdown to pdf or html earth data science. Create professional reports that document our workflow and results directly from our code, reducing the risk of accidental copy and paste or. With the free html to pdf converter from selectpdf, you can convert any url, html file or html string to pdf, with the possibility to add custom headers and footers. Outputstream and add a couple of custom headers to the output. This simpler approach to adding a save to pdf function is demonstrated in fonts available when using visualforce pdf.